Maya Cement Plant is a cement plant in El Salvador. Its listed capacity is 1,900,000 t of cement. Cement plants heat limestone to 1,400°C in rotary kilns — one of the hottest industrial processes — and must control temperature precisely across the entire kiln length. It is operated by Holcim El Salvador SA de CV. By capacity it ranks #1 among 2 cement plants in El Salvador. It emits about 614,387 t CO₂e a year from Climate TRACE. That is 45% of the CO₂e from the 3 facilities in El Salvador that have an emissions figure in IndustryAtlas. Its CO₂ per unit of capacity is 11% below the national median for this sector.

Carbon cost and Scope 1 emissions
At its reported 614k t CO₂e/yr (Scope 1), Maya Cement Plant carries no domestic carbon price — and as a CBAM-covered product, its 614k t at the EU CBAM rate (€75/t) is €46.3M/yr of exposure on EU-bound exports. CBAM share rises from 2.5% (2026) to 100% by 2034. No domestic carbon price — but cement, steel, aluminium, fertilizer and hydrogen exported to the EU face CBAM at €75/t (rising to 100% by 2034).
